Public procurement in the decision­making practice of the Office of Public Procurement and the case law of the ECJ
Ptáček, Přemysl ; Horáček, Tomáš (advisor) ; Liška, Petr (referee)
Public procurement in the decision-making practice of the Office of Public Procurement and the case law of the ECJ Abstract This thesis deals with the issue of public procurement and is focused primarily on the decision-making practice of the Office for the Protection of Economic Competition and the Court of Justice of the European Union. The thesis contains a critical analysis of several decisions, which were chosen, in particular for their possible impact on the practice of public procurement, as well as for their recency. The introductory part of the thesis is primarily theoretical. In the first chapter, the basic sources of law are described, while in the second chapter, definitions of the most important basic terms of the Act on Public Procurement are described. The third chapter describes the procedural options for defense against incorrect procedure of the contracting authority. The role of the Court of Justice of the European Union in these proceedings is also mentioned. The key part of the thesis is the fourth chapter, which contains a critical analysis of selected recent decisions (mostly from 2022 and 2023).
